When Stephanie was about five she and I were headed to McDonald's one day.
On the way we passed a terrible car accident.
Usually when we see something like that,
we would say a prayer for those who might be hurt.
So I pointed to the accident and said, "We should pray."
From the back seat I heard her heartfelt prayer:
"Please, God, don't let those cars block the entrance to McDonald's."
You never know what a child will come up with, do you?

The Lord's Prayer Words
Our Father, who art in heaven,hallowed be thy name.
Thy Kingdom come, thy will be done, on earth as it is in heaven
Give us this day our daily bread.
And forgive us our trespasses,as we forgive those who trespass against us.
And lead us not into temptation, but deliver us from evil. For thine is the kingdom,
the power and the glory,
for ever and ever. Amen
(Mat. 6.9–13; Luke 11.2–4) so important that HE told us twice!
